DrupalCon Dublin 2016: 21 things i learned with Twig & Drupal
About this talk
This talk explores the significant transition from phptemplate to Twig in Drupal 8 theming, highlighting the need for a new mindset regarding Drupal theming practices. The speaker presents hands-on insights gained from years of experience with the Drupal Twig group, addressing the community's common question about how to approach theming correctly from the start. Key topics include understanding template suggestions, organizing multiple template files, the role of base themes, modern CSS structures, and effective developer tools. The session is aimed at web designers, frontend developers, and anyone interested in mastering the nuances of Drupal 8 theming, with a foundational knowledge of Twig recommended for attendees.
